Cameroonian farmer enriches local market with fruits introduced from China
In the small town of Souza in Cameroon’s Littoral Region, 35-year-old farmer Arnold Kogaing has achieved great success cultivating fruits.
Before establishing his own farm in 2019, Arnold studied in China for nine years and earned both a bachelor’s and a master’s degree.
Moreover, the Chinese friends he made during the stay introduced him to the opportunities to plant fruit.
Over the years, his Chinese friends have helped Kogaing to import fruit varieties from China and taught him advanced techniques in agriculture.
